What are SN1 vs SN2 flashcards?
SN1 vs SN2 flashcards cover the fundamental differences between unimolecular and bimolecular nucleophilic substitution reactions. These cards focus on identifying substrates, leaving groups, nucleophile strength, solvent effects, and stereochemical outcomes.
Instead of staring at a reaction coordinate diagram and hoping it sticks, these flashcards force you to test your knowledge of reaction pathways. You build active recall by predicting products and identifying the rate-determining steps of each mechanism.

Why flashcards are one of the best ways to study SN1 vs SN2
Organic chemistry requires more than just memorization; it requires the ability to distinguish between competing pathways. Flashcards are perfect for this because they isolate the variables that determine whether a reaction follows an SN1 or SN2 route.
By using active recall and spaced repetition, you train your brain to recognize patterns—like seeing a secondary alkyl halide and a polar aprotic solvent and immediately thinking 'SN2'.
Distinguish between protic and aprotic solvents instantly.
Memorize the order of carbocation stability (3° > 2° > 1°).
Compare inversion of configuration vs. racemization.
Practice identifying strong vs. weak nucleophiles.
What to include in your SN1 vs SN2 flashcards
The most effective SN1 vs SN2 flashcards follow the "one idea per card" rule. Instead of asking 'What is the difference between SN1 and SN2?', ask specific questions about kinetics or stereochemistry.
Focus on these four main categories to ensure full mastery:
Definitions & Kinetics: "What is the rate law for an SN2 reaction?"
Substrate & Stability: "Why do tertiary halides favor SN1?"
Stereochemistry: "Which mechanism results in a racemic mixture?"
Solvent Effects: "How does a polar protic solvent affect the rate of SN2?"
Example prompts for your deck: 'Identify the rate-determining step in SN1,' 'Predict the product of (S)-2-bromobutane + NaOH,' 'List three strong nucleophiles,' and 'What is the effect of doubling nucleophile concentration in SN2?'
How to study SN1 vs SN2 with flashcards (a simple system)
To master organic chemistry reactions, use a two-pass approach. First, generate your deck to establish the basic rules, then use the cards to solve practice problems.
Keep your sessions short but frequent. Reviewing 10-15 cards for 10 minutes a day is more effective than a four-hour cram session the night before your exam.

Common SN1 vs SN2 flashcard mistakes (and how to fix them)
Many students make cards that are too vague, which leads to 'recognition' rather than 'recall.' Avoid these traps:
Cards are too long: Don't put the whole reaction summary on one card. Split the rate law, substrate, and solvent into separate cards.
Ignoring stereochemistry: Always include a card specifically for 'inversion' or 'racemization.'
Forgetting solvent trends: Make distinct cards for polar protic vs. polar aprotic impacts.
No practice problems: Don't just memorize definitions; include 'What is the product?' cards with a simple drawing.
